Per reporting by World Nuclear News, Nuclear Engineering International, and POWER, **Blue Energy**, **GE Vernova**, and partners are advancing a phased "gas-to-nuclear" delivery model that uses initial natural-gas-fired turbines to energize a site while small modular reactors are licensed and built. Sources report the Texas project targets approximately **2.5 GW** total capacity, with an initial gas phase of about **1 GWe** using two GE Vernova `7HA.02` turbines and a later `BWRX-300` SMR phase of roughly **1.5 GWe** (Nuclear Engineering International; World Nuclear News). Reporting also notes a target final investment decision in **2027** and a slot reservation for turbine delivery in **2029** (World Nuclear News; Nuclear Engineering International).
